Sales Operation Specialist

RadNet is a company focused on operational excellence across the commercial organization. The Sales Operations Specialist plays a key role in coordinating sales operations, ensuring data integrity, and supporting the sales team through Salesforce and other systems.

Responsibilities

Coordinate the full contract lifecycle, ensuring accurate Salesforce documentation, seamless handoffs to Services and Finance, and timely updates across related objects (Assets, Contracts, Opportunities)
Apply critical thinking to identify data inconsistencies, troubleshoot issues, and implement solutions that improve forecasting and revenue tracking
Maintain and optimize Sales Operations workflows, including Salesforce data updates, reporting, and cross-functional team support for pipeline visibility, renewal tracking, and customer engagement
Act as the primary point of contact for sales operations support, triaging and tracking requests and resolving or escalating issues with speed and accuracy
Collaborate with Finance, Services and Sales to uphold data integrity and ensure alignment on booking forecasts and revenue conversion
Integrate data from multiple platforms (Salesforce, Marketo, Excel) to produce reliable insights and eliminate duplication
Support lead generation efforts by managing Salesforce campaign data, tracking performance, and ensuring smooth integration between sales and marketing systems
Deliver Salesforce training and documentation to empower the sales team and promote best practices in data hygiene and task management
Manage supplier and partner portals (e.g., GE, AWS), ensuring accurate data flow and operational alignment

Required

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ience required
5+ years of experience in sales operations, CRM administration, commercial support roles or related experience
Proficiency in Salesforce, with experience in reporting, data management, and user support
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a keen eye for detail and data accuracy
Excellent communication and coordination abilities across cross-functional teams
Proficiency with MS Excel and ability to learn other supporting software tools as needed

Preferred

Familiarity with marketing automation platforms (e.g., Marketo) and ERP systems is a plus
